Paws::ElastiCache::DesUsereContributedtPerlhDocumecribeCacheParameterGroups(3) NAME Paws::ElastiCache::DescribeCacheParameterGroups - Arguments for method DescribeCacheParameterGroups on Paws::ElastiCache DESCRIPTION This class represents the parameters used for calling the method DescribeCacheParameterGroups on the Amazon ElastiCache service. Use the attributes of this class as arguments to method DescribeCacheParameterGroups. You shouln't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the call to DescribeCacheParameterGroups. As an example: $service_obj->DescribeCacheParameterGroups(Att1 => $value1, Att2 => $value2, ...); Values for attributes that are native types (Int, String, Float, etc) can passed as-is (scalar values). Values for complex Types (objects) can be passed as a HashRef. The keys and values of the hashref will be used to instance the underlying object. ATTRIBUTES CacheParameterGroupName => Str The name of a specific cache parameter group to return details for. Marker => Str An optional marker returned from a prior request. Use this marker for pagination of results from this action. If this parameter is specified, the response includes only records beyond the marker, up to the value specified by MaxRecords. MaxRecords => Int The maximum number of records to include in the response. If more records exist than the specified "MaxRecords" value, a marker is included in the response so that the remaining results can be retrieved. Default: 100 Constraints: minimum 20; maximum 100.
